WebA right triangle is a triangle in which one of the angles is 90°, and is denoted by two line segments forming a square at the vertex constituting the right angle. The longest edge of a right triangle, which is the edge opposite the right angle, is called the hypotenuse. WebArcsecant is the inverse of the secant, which is the ratio of the hypotenuse, or longest side, to the adjacent side in a right triangle. Right Triangle Diagram (CC By-SA 3.0 Wikimedia ) The hypotenuse is the longest side which constrains the arcsecant. The major functions of trigonometry ... hairness salonWeb13 Mar 2024 · Secant. The secant is the reciprocal trigonometric ratio of the cosine. It is the reciprocal or multiplicative inverse of the cosine, that is, sec θ · cos θ = 1.
